Original n8n.io sourceThis workflow is designed for users who want to implement iterative AI-powered content improvement processes. It's ideal for content creators, marketers, product managers, and anyone who needs to refine ideas through multiple rounds of critique and enhancement until they meet quality standards.
The workflow creates a sophisticated feedback loop using three specialized AI agents that work together to continuously improve content. Starting with an initial input (like a product description), the system generates ideas and then enters a reasoning loop where:
A Critic Agent analyzes the current output and identifies flaws or areas for improvement A Refiner Agent takes the original input plus the critic's feedback to create enhanced versions An Evaluator Agent assesses the refined output and determines if it meets the quality threshold
The loop continues until either the evaluator determines the output is satisfactory or a maximum number of iterations is reached (configurable, default is 5 turns).
n8n workflow environment Access to AI/LLM nodes (OpenAI, Anthropic, etc.) Basic understanding of JSON data structures Configured AI model credentials
How to customize the workflow Customize the system prompts for each agent based on your specific use case. The critic should focus on your quality criteria, the refiner should understand your improvement goals, and the evaluator should have clear success metrics. Adjust the maximum iteration count in the code node and IF condition based on your complexity needs and token budget considerations.
